{-# LANGUAGE RecordWildCards #-}
{-# LANGUAGE RecursiveDo     #-}

module Potato.Flow.Vty.Layer (
  LayerWidgetConfig(..)
  , LayerWidget(..)
  , holdLayerWidget
) where

import           Relude

import           Potato.Flow
import           Potato.Flow.Vty.Attrs
import           Potato.Flow.Vty.Input
import           Potato.Reflex.Vty.Helpers
import Potato.Flow.Vty.PotatoReader
import Potato.Flow.Vty.Common
import Potato.Reflex.Vty.Widget.ScrollBar
import Potato.Reflex.Vty.Widget.TextInputHelpers


import qualified Potato.Data.Text.Zipper
import qualified Data.List                   as L
import qualified Data.Sequence               as Seq
import qualified Data.Text                   as T
import qualified Data.Text.Zipper            as TZ

import qualified Graphics.Vty                as V
import           Reflex
import           Reflex.Vty



-- | simple conversion function
-- potato-flow does not want to depend on reflex an has a coppy of TextZipper library but they are pretty much the same
coerceZipper :: Potato.Data.Text.Zipper.TextZipper -> TZ.TextZipper
coerceZipper (Potato.Data.Text.Zipper.TextZipper a b c d) = TZ.TextZipper a b c d

--moveChar :: Char
--moveChar = '≡'
hiddenChar :: Char
hiddenChar = '-'
visibleChar :: Char
visibleChar = 'e'
lockedChar :: Char
lockedChar = '@'
unlockedChar :: Char
unlockedChar = 'a'
expandChar :: Char
expandChar = '»'
closeChar :: Char
closeChar = '⇊'

{-# INLINE if' #-}
if' :: Bool -> a -> a -> a
if' True  x _ = x
if' False _ y = y


data LayerWidgetConfig t = LayerWidgetConfig {
  _layerWidgetConfig_layers    :: Dynamic t LayersState
  , _layerWidgetConfig_layersView    :: Dynamic t LayersViewHandlerRenderOutput
  , _layerWidgetConfig_selection :: Dynamic t Selection
}

data LayerWidget t = LayerWidget {
  _layerWidget_mouse :: Event t LMouseData
  , _layerWidget_newFolderEv :: Event t ()
}

layerContents :: forall t m. (MonadWidget t m, HasPotato t m)
  => LayerWidgetConfig t
  -> Dynamic t (Int, Int)
  -> m (Event t LMouseData)
layerContents LayerWidgetConfig {..} scrollDyn = do


  potatostylebeh <- fmap _potatoConfig_style askPotato
  PotatoStyle {..} <- sample potatostylebeh

  regionWidthDyn <- displayWidth
  regionHeightDyn <- displayHeight


  let
    padBottom = 0
    listRegionDyn = ffor2 regionWidthDyn regionHeightDyn (,)


    makeLayerImage :: Int -> LayersHandlerRenderEntry -> V.Image
    makeLayerImage width lhrentry = case lhrentry of
      LayersHandlerRenderEntryDummy ident -> r where
        r = V.text' lg_layer_selected . T.pack . L.take width
          $ 
          replicate (max 0 (ident-1)) ' '
          <> (if ident > 0 then "└" else "")
          <> " "
          <> replicate 10 '*'
      LayersHandlerRenderEntryNormal selected mdots mrenaming lentry@LayerEntry{..} -> r where
        ident = layerEntry_depth lentry
        sowl = _layerEntry_superOwl
        label = hasOwlItem_name sowl

        attr = case selected of
          LHRESS_Selected -> _potatoStyle_selected
          LHRESS_InheritSelected -> _potatoStyle_selected
          LHRESS_ChildSelected -> _potatoStyle_layers_softSelected
          _ -> _potatoStyle_normal

        -- TODO correct styles so they aren't confused with selected styles (you should add colors)
        attrrenamingbg = _potatoStyle_layers_softSelected
        attrrenamingcur = _potatoStyle_selected

        identn = case mdots of
          Nothing -> ident
          Just x -> x - 1

        icon = case _owlItem_subItem (_superOwl_elt sowl) of 
          OwlSubItemFolder _ -> "𐃛"
          OwlSubItemBox _ -> "⧈"
          OwlSubItemLine _ -> "⤡"
          OwlSubItemTextArea _ -> "𐂂"
          _ -> "?"

        t1 = V.text' attr . T.pack $

          -- render identation and possible drop depth
          replicate identn ' '
          <> replicate (min 1 (ident - identn)) '|'
          <> replicate (max 0 (ident - identn - 1)) ' '

          -- render folder hide lock icons
          -- <> [moveChar]
          <> if' (layerEntry_isFolder lentry) (if' _layerEntry_isCollapsed [expandChar] [closeChar]) ['●']
          <> if' (lockHiddenStateToBool _layerEntry_hideState) [hiddenChar] [visibleChar]
          <> if' (lockHiddenStateToBool _layerEntry_lockState) [lockedChar] [unlockedChar]
          <> " " 
          <> icon
          <> " "

        t2 = case mrenaming of
          Nothing -> V.text' attr label
          Just renaming -> img where
            dls = TZ.displayLines 999999 attrrenamingbg attrrenamingcur (coerceZipper renaming)
            img = V.vertCat . images . addCursorSpace $ TZ._displayLines_spans dls

        r = t1 V.<|> t2

    layerImages :: Behavior t [V.Image]
    layerImages = current $ fmap ((:[]) . V.vertCat)
      $ ffor3 listRegionDyn (fmap _layersViewHandlerRenderOutput_entries _layerWidgetConfig_layersView) scrollDyn $ \(w,h) lhrentries scroll ->
        map (makeLayerImage w) . L.take (max 0 (h - padBottom)) . L.drop (snd scroll) $ toList lhrentries
  tellImages layerImages

  layerInpEv_d3 <- makeLMouseDataInputEv scrollDyn True
  return layerInpEv_d3

holdLayerWidget :: forall t m. (MonadWidget t m, HasPotato t m)
  => LayerWidgetConfig t
  -> m (LayerWidget t)
holdLayerWidget lwc@LayerWidgetConfig {..} = do

  regionWidthDyn <- displayWidth
  --regionHeightDyn <- displayHeight

  (layerInpEv, newFolderEv) <- initLayout $ col $ mdo
    -- layer contents and scroll bar
    layerInpEv_d1 <- (grout . stretch) 1 $ row $ mdo

      -- the layer list itself
      (layerInpEv_d2, listRegionHeightDyn) <- (grout . stretch) 0 $ col $ do
        listRegionHeightDyn_d1 <- displayHeight
        layerInpEv_d3 <- layerContents lwc (fmap (\y -> (0,y)) vScrollDyn)
        return (layerInpEv_d3, listRegionHeightDyn_d1)

      -- the vertical scroll bar
      vScrollDyn <- (grout . fixed) 1 $ col $ do
        let
          contentSizeDyn = fmap ((+1) . Seq.length . _layersViewHandlerRenderOutput_entries) _layerWidgetConfig_layersView
        vScrollBar 1 contentSizeDyn

      return layerInpEv_d2

    -- TODO horizontal scroll bar somedays

    -- buttons at the bottom
    (newFolderEv_d1, heightDyn) <- (grout . fixed) heightDyn $ row $ do
      (buttonsEv, heightDyn_d1) <- buttonList (constDyn ["new folder"]) (Just regionWidthDyn)
      -- TODO new layer/delete buttons how here
      -- TODO other folder options too maybe?
      return (ffilterButtonIndex 0 buttonsEv, heightDyn_d1)

    return (layerInpEv_d1, newFolderEv_d1)


  return $ LayerWidget {
      _layerWidget_mouse = layerInpEv
      , _layerWidget_newFolderEv = newFolderEv
    }
